The Full Story
The core of today’s announcement revolves around a series of protocol enhancements for the Peaq Network blockchain. These upgrades are primarily focused on increasing transaction throughput and reducing confirmation times, crucial factors for any network aiming to handle a high volume of real-world transactions. Details released by the Peaq team indicate the implementation of new consensus mechanisms and optimized data handling processes. Furthermore, the upgrade promises improved interoperability with other blockchain networks, a vital feature for fostering a connected Web3 ecosystem.
This isn’t just about making the network faster; it’s about laying the groundwork for more complex decentralized applications. By enhancing scalability, Peaq aims to accommodate a larger number of users and devices that can participate in and benefit from its DePIN ecosystem. The improved interoperability means that assets and data managed on Peaq can more seamlessly interact with applications and platforms on other blockchains, unlocking new possibilities for collaboration and innovation.
The development team has been working diligently on these upgrades, with extensive testing conducted over the past several months. The phased rollout plan suggests that users will see the benefits of these changes progressively, ensuring a smooth transition without disrupting ongoing operations within the network. This careful approach highlights the project’s commitment to stability and reliability as it scales.
Strategic Analysis
Why is this Peaq Network upgrade so important? At its heart, DePIN is about connecting the digital and physical worlds. For a DePIN project to truly succeed, its underlying technology needs to be capable of handling the complexities and demands of real-world operations. This upgrade directly addresses those needs by boosting the network’s capacity and flexibility.
Enhanced scalability is not just a technical buzzword; it’s fundamental for widespread adoption. Imagine millions of devices, from electric vehicles to renewable energy grids, interacting with a blockchain network. Without the ability to process a vast number of transactions quickly and affordably, such a system would quickly become unusable. Peaq’s upgrade tackles this head-on, making it more feasible for a diverse range of physical assets to be managed and utilized through its decentralized infrastructure.
The focus on interoperability is equally strategic. The future of Web3 is not a single, isolated blockchain, but a network of interconnected chains. By making Peaq more compatible with other networks, the project opens itself up to a wider array of developers and applications. This means that real-world assets registered on Peaq could potentially be used as collateral in decentralized finance protocols on other chains, or their operational data could feed into cross-chain analytical tools. This interconnectedness is key to unlocking the full potential of Web3 real-world assets.
